The Fundamentals of Baccarat

At its core, Baccarat is a comparing card game played between two hands: the «Player» and the «Banker.» The objective is simple: to bet on which hand will have a total value closest to nine. Unlike many other card games, the player does not directly play against the dealer; instead, they bet on the outcome of the Player hand, the Banker hand, or a Tie. The game’s appeal lies in its minimal player involvement in decision-making, allowing for a relaxed and engaging gameplay experience.

Card values in Baccarat are straightforward:

  • Face cards (King, Queen, Jack) and Tens are all worth zero.
  • Aces are worth one.
  • All other cards are worth their face value (e.g., a 7 is worth 7).
The total value of a hand is determined by adding the values of the cards, but only the last digit of the sum is considered. For instance, a hand with a 7 and a 6 totals 13, which counts as 3 in Baccarat. A hand with a 9 and an 8 totals 17, counting as 7.

How to Play Online Baccarat: Step-by-Step

Playing online Baccarat is an intuitive process, even for those unfamiliar with the game. The steps are generally consistent across most online casinos catering to UK players.

Placing Your Bet

Before any cards are dealt, you must place your wager. You have three primary betting options:

  • Player: Betting that the Player hand will win.
  • Banker: Betting that the Banker hand will win. This bet typically has a slightly lower payout due to the Banker’s statistical advantage.
  • Tie: Betting that both the Player and Banker hands will have the same total value. This is the riskiest bet with the highest payout.
Some online variations may also offer side bets, which we will explore later.

The Deal

Once bets are placed, two cards are dealt face up to the Player hand and two cards face up to the Banker hand. The rules for drawing a third card are predetermined and do not involve player decisions, which is a key feature of Baccarat.

Determining the Winner

The hand closest to nine wins. If the Player hand totals eight or nine, it is a «natural» win, and no further cards are drawn. The same applies if the Banker hand totals eight or nine. If neither hand is a natural, the game proceeds to the third card rule.

The Third Card Rule

The rules for drawing a third card are fixed and depend on the initial totals of both hands.

  • Player’s Rule: If the Player’s initial two-card total is 5 or less, they draw a third card. If it is 6 or more, they stand.
  • Banker’s Rule: The Banker’s action depends on the Player’s action and the Banker’s own total. If the Player stands, the Banker draws if their total is 5 or less. If the Player draws, the Banker’s action is more complex and is based on a specific table of rules that dictates whether they draw or stand based on their current total and the value of the Player’s third card.
These rules are automatically applied by the online casino software, so you don’t need to memorise them to play.

Variations of Online Baccarat

While the core game remains the same, online casinos offer several variations to keep the gameplay fresh and exciting. Understanding these can enhance your strategic approach and betting opportunities.

Punto Banco

This is the most common version of Baccarat played online and in casinos worldwide. It is the version described above, where all third card rules are predetermined and no player decisions are involved beyond placing bets. It is often referred to simply as «Baccarat» in online settings.

Speed Baccarat

As the name suggests, Speed Baccarat is a faster-paced version. Rounds are significantly shorter, with bets placed quickly and cards dealt face down and then revealed rapidly. This variation is ideal for players who enjoy a high-octane gaming experience and are comfortable making rapid decisions.

Live Dealer Baccarat

Live Dealer Baccarat offers the most immersive online experience. Real dealers host the game from a professional studio, and the action is streamed live to your device in high definition. Players can interact with the dealer and sometimes other players via a chat function, replicating the social aspect of a land-based casino. This variation often includes additional side bets and interactive features.

No Commission Baccarat

In standard Baccarat, a commission (typically 5%) is charged on winning Banker bets. No Commission Baccarat removes this commission, making Banker bets more attractive. However, a special rule usually applies: if the Banker wins with a total of six, the payout is halved (often referred to as «6-5» payout), effectively reintroducing a house edge.

Random Number Generators (RNGs)

In non-live dealer Baccarat, Random Number Generators (RNGs) are used to ensure the fairness and randomness of card distribution. These sophisticated algorithms are regularly audited by independent third-party testing agencies to guarantee that the outcomes are truly random and that the games are not manipulated.

Regulation and Responsible Gambling in the UK

The online gambling industry in the UK is highly regulated, providing a safe environment for players. The Gambling Commission oversees all licensed operators, ensuring compliance with strict rules.

Licensing and Compliance

Any online casino operating legally in the UK must hold a valid license from the Gambling Commission. This license signifies that the operator meets rigorous standards for player protection, game fairness, and responsible gambling practices. Players can typically find licensing information at the bottom of an online casino’s website.

Player Protection Measures

Licensed operators are mandated to implement measures to protect players. These include:

  • Age Verification: Robust systems to prevent underage gambling.
  • Self-Exclusion: Tools allowing players to exclude themselves from gambling for a specified period.
  • Deposit Limits: Options for players to set daily, weekly, or monthly deposit limits.
  • Reality Checks: Pop-up notifications reminding players of the time spent playing and their wins/losses.

Responsible gambling is a cornerstone of the UK’s regulatory framework, and players are encouraged to gamble within their means.

Strategic Considerations for Online Baccarat

While Baccarat is largely a game of chance with predetermined rules, a few strategic considerations can enhance the player’s experience.

Understanding House Edge

Each bet in Baccarat has a different house edge. The Banker bet generally has the lowest house edge (around 1.06% excluding commission), followed by the Player bet (around 1.24%). The Tie bet has a significantly higher house edge (often over 14%), making it the least favourable option in the long run.

Bankroll Management

Effective bankroll management is crucial for any form of gambling. Players should set a budget for their gaming sessions and stick to it. It is advisable to divide your bankroll into smaller units and avoid chasing losses. A common strategy is to set a win goal and a loss limit for each session.

Avoiding Side Bets

While side bets can offer exciting payouts, they typically come with a much higher house edge than the main game bets. For players focused on maximising their chances and minimising the house’s advantage, it is generally recommended to stick to the Player or Banker bets.
